Solution for 12x-3=2x equation:


Simplifying
12x + -3 = 2x

Reorder the terms:
-3 + 12x = 2x

Solving
-3 + 12x = 2x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-2x' to each side of the equation.
-3 + 12x + -2x = 2x + -2x

Combine like terms: 12x + -2x = 10x
-3 + 10x = 2x + -2x

Combine like terms: 2x + -2x = 0
-3 + 10x = 0

Add '3' to each side of the equation.
-3 + 3 + 10x = 0 + 3

Combine like terms: -3 + 3 = 0
0 + 10x = 0 + 3
10x = 0 + 3

Combine like terms: 0 + 3 = 3
10x = 3

Divide each side by '10'.
x = 0.3

Simplifying
x = 0.3
